I did not buy any databases lol, MJJC was a fresh start by me and a couple of other admins when Trish decided to close MJJF, there is no post content here from MJJF the only thing we did which was agreed between us was to migrate the user accounts so members didn't have to re-register.

I completely rebuilt the place on a brand new platform taking it into the future.
